“Life is not fair, and it never will be. Stop expecting fairness, build resilience, or get left behind.”'
Things won’t line up how you want them to. You won’t always get the opportunities you think you deserve, and effort won’t always be noticed or rewarded straight away. That’s just reality.
Waiting for things to be fair is a waste of time. It doesn’t change outcomes; it only slows you down. The people who move forward aren’t the ones who complain the least; they’re the ones who accept reality and keep working anyway.
You will get knocked back. You will lose chances. You will deal with situations that feel unjust. None of that matters in the long run unless you let it stop you.
What separates people is simple: some adapt, keep training, keep learning, keep improving, others stop because it “wasn’t fair.”
In the end, fairness doesn’t decide your future. Consistency does. Discipline does. What you do when things aren’t fair is what defines you.
